    World Famous Rendezvous Dry BBQ Ribs

    Quoted message said:

    From Nick Vergos of Charlie Vergos Rendezvous restaurant, Memphis, Tenn.


    In Memphis, it's been a long-running debate. What's better, wet ribs or
    dry
    ribs?

    Decide for yourself, here's the recipe for dry ribs from famous Memphis
    rib
    joint, Charlie Vergos Rendezvous. Then try the wet ribs recipe!

    4 cups white distilled vinegar
    4 cups water
    1/3 cup Rendezvous Famous Seasoning Rub
    2 slabs pork loin back ribs (approximately 2 pounds each)

    Mix vinegar, water and seasoning together to make your basting sauce.
    Cook meat over direct heat on the grill, approximately 18-inches above
    fire. Coals should be at 325 to 350 degrees. Start ribs bone side down,
    until bone side is golden brown. Baste 2 times with basting sauce then
    flip slab and cook meat side down until this side reaches a nice golden
    brown. The meat is ready when it is so hot that you cannot touch it with
    your fingers. That is approximately 30 minutes per side. Baste again and
    sprinkle with Rendezvous world famous seasoning and you are ready to
    serve.

    Yield: 4 servings
    Prep Time: 5 minutes
    Cook Time: 1 hour

    Rendezvous Seasoning Rub

    1/2 cup salt
    1/4 cup pepper
    1 Tbsp garlic powder
    1 Tbsp oregano
    1 Tbsp celery seed
    1 Tbsp paprika
    1 Tbsp chile powder

    Combine ingredients and set-aside.

    Recipe courtesy Nick Vergos of Charlie Vergos Rendezvous restaurant,
    Memphis
    Tenn. © 2002.
